Jan. 22nd, 2012 01:40 amI was bored, so I tried some random movies.
Hackers. The novelty of Johnny Lee Miller trying to play 18 wore off in about ten seconds. The lack of anything interesting or plot-like finally caused me to give up. (seriously, this movie is so boring) Managed: about half an hour before giving up.
Sky Captain and the World of Tomorrow. Entertaining, but also sort of boring. And the cinematography kept throwing me out of the story. Julian Curry's cameo made me hopeful, though. I liked the plucky girldetective reporter. Managed: almost an hour, I think.
Love and Other Disasters. I've always liked Brittany Murphy, and the surprise!Catherine Tate was highly appreciated. Entertaining and adorable, and amusing enough to keep me watching. Managed: the whole movie.
